Master the art of making easy cream-based madeleine cookies with our step-by-step guide to this classic French pastry delight!
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 27 minutes
Course Dessert, Snack
Cuisine French
Servings 24 cookies
Calories 120 kcal

Ingredients
  

Basic Ingredients

  • 3 large eggs room temperature - Provides structure and lift
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ar - Creates tenderness and helps achieve golden-brown color
  • cups all-purpose flour - Forms the cookie's foundation
  • ¾ cup unsalted butter melted - Delivers rich, buttery flavor

Special Cream-Based Additions

  • ½ cup heavy cream - Adds moisture and richness
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ract - Enhances flavor depth
  • ¼ teaspoon salt - Balances sweetness

Instructions
 

Step 1: Prepare the Batter

  • In a large mixing bowl, beat 3 large eggs and ¾ cup granulated sugar together using an electric mixer or whisk for 5-7 minutes until the mixture becomes pale, fluffy, and reaches the "ribbon stage" (the batter should fall in thick ribbons when lifted).
  • Sift 1½ cups all-purpose flour, ¼ teaspoon salt, and 1 teaspoon baking powder into the egg mixture.
  • Gently fold the dry ingredients into the egg mixture using a rubber spatula until just combined. Avoid overmixing.

Step 2: Add Cream and Butter

  • Slowly pour ½ cup heavy cream into the batter while gently folding.
  • Gradually add ¾ cup melted unsalted butter (cooled slightly) around the edges of the bowl, folding until the batter is smooth and glossy.

Step 3: Chill the Batter

  •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ate the batter for 30-60 minutes. This step is crucial for developing the signature hump and texture.

Step 4: Preheat and Prepare the Pan

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(177°C).
  • Brush the molds of a Madeleine pan with melted butter and lightly dust with flour to prevent sticking.

Step 5: Fill the Molds

  • Spoon or pipe the chilled batter into the prepared Madeleine molds, filling each about ¾ full.

Step 6: Bake

  •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own and the centers spring back when lightly touched.
  • Remove from the oven and let the cookies cool in the pan for 2-3 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 7: Decorate and Serve

  • Dust the cooled Madeleines with powdered sugar or drizzle with melted chocolate for an elegant touch.
  • Serve with tea, coffee, or as a delightful dessert.
